I think if you are talking about $x-xx domains they go best in the forums. Sedo/Afternic have minimum commissions which make it impossible to sell those domains at those prices. TDNAM only have $5 minimum commission, so it's worth a shot there. But it's a crowded marketplace. To compensate that, it has lots of eyeballs looking for bargains.

The $xxx-xxxx domains I'd put on Sedo/Afternic for sure. But it's often along wait for a sale.
